If you need a reliable way to track your spending, using an expense receipts template is an excellent option. A clear and simple template ensures that each receipt is accurately recorded, making it easier to manage your finances and submit expense reports. By using a template, you save time and avoid errors that could lead to confusion or discrepancies later on.

expense receipts template

Start by including key details on the template such as the date of the purchase, vendor name, description of the item or service, amount spent, and payment method. These fields help maintain a clean and organized record, allowing you to quickly reference any transaction without hunting through piles of receipts. If you’re using this for business purposes, including the project or department code will make reporting even smoother.

For added convenience, consider including a column to track tax amounts separately from the total cost. This makes it easy to calculate tax deductions and simplifies the process during tax season. If you frequently make similar purchases, having a customizable template can save even more time. Just make sure your template is flexible enough to accommodate different types of expenses.

Create a simple expense receipt template by including key details for clarity and accuracy. Start by adding a section for the receipt number, date, and business name. These fields are crucial for easy tracking and referencing. Add a space for the vendor’s name, contact details, and address to identify the source of the expense. Next, clearly list the items or services purchased, along with their costs, quantities, and any applicable tax amounts.

To customize this template for various business needs, include fields for project codes or client names if your business requires specific tracking. For instance, a freelancer may need a section for client information, while a retail store might include payment method details. For companies that frequently process reimbursements, consider adding a “reimbursement approval” field to keep things organized.

Once the basic fields are set, ensure that there’s space for signatures, if necessary, to confirm the validity of the expense. Make the layout simple and clean, with a clear hierarchy of information for easy scanning. This structure helps both your accounting team and tax professionals work more efficiently. Tailor the template based on your business’s specific expenses to avoid clutter while still capturing all the necessary data.
